for(inti=1;i<=c;i++){//遍历所有的已经存在的车 if(nums[now]+car[i]<=k){ //now物品可以放在编号为i的这辆车上 car[i]+=nums[now]; dfs(now+1,c);//下一个物品,仍是当前车 car[i]-=nums[now];//回溯 } } //如果所有的物品都不能放在now这辆车上,则新增一辆车 car[c+1]+=nums...
C语言网提供由在职研发工程师或ACM蓝桥杯竞赛优秀选手录制的视频教程,并配有习题和答疑,点击了解: 一点编程也不会写的:零基础C语言学练课程 解决困扰你多年的C语言疑难杂症特性的C语言进阶课程 从零到写出一个爬虫的Python编程课程 只会语法写不出代码?手把手带你写100个编程真题的编程百练课程 信息学奥赛或C++...
#include #include #define INF 65535 using namespace std; int vis[100][100]; //路径长度 int map[100][100]; //迷宫地图 typedef pair P; //节点坐标 P p; int dx[4] = {
BFS和DFS模板,BFS#include<cstdio>#include<cstring>#include<queue>#include<algorithm>usi{0,1,0,-
DFS用的是栈。搜了k层的点a,再搜k+1层的点b,再搜k+2层的点c。搜到c时,当前点标记为b,搜完c若返回false,那么就会回来从b再向下别的方向进行搜索。搜索了这个点,还可能回来再搜这个点向下的别的方向。 模板 ''' 递归 '''visited=set()defdfs(node,visited):ifnodeinvisited:returnvisited.add(node)...
现浇模板 箱涵现浇模板供应商 框架梁现浇模板供应商 JS品牌 嘉兴博溢塑料制品有限公司 1年 查看详情 ¥310.00/平方米 浙江嘉兴 拱形骨架现浇模板 现浇模板支撑图片 框架梁现浇模板供应商 JS品牌 嘉兴博溢塑料制品有限公司 1年 查看详情 ¥650.00/套 河北保定 华旭现浇框架梁钢模板 混凝土框架梁钢模板工厂...
查看C'est notre devise的博客:小说博客加为好友和我聊天 我!大秦五公子,开局卡普模板 爱喝冰糖雪梨 大类:军事历史小类:穿越时空字数:1759897字阅读:7089477次 更新:23年05月07日状态:完成 简介:穿越到大秦,苏子皓成为了大秦帝国的五公子,嬴子皓!不甘成为胡亥与赵高的刀下鬼,嬴子皓想要掌控自己的命运!嬴子皓...
教师 只有编程教师 学生 只有工院学生 程序员 科研人员 工人 医生 (多选题)如果我们打算编一程序万年历,你认为其意义何在? 学以致用,值得鼓励 运用想象力完善以往的万年历,值得期待 难度很大,值得尝试 做得好的话,会鼓励更多人学习C语言 没有意义,赚不了钱 我不懂C语言,问我没什么卵用 相关...
bfs与dfs详解(经典例题 + 模板c-代码) 文章目录 模板+解析 dfs bfs 1562. 微博转发 3502. 不同路径数 165. 小猫爬山 模板+解析 DFS(深度优先搜索)和BFS(广度优先搜索)是图论中两个重要的算法。 dfs 其中DFS是一种用于遍历或搜索树或图的算法,BFS则是一种用于搜索或遍历树或图的算法。两种算法都有其自身...
知道DFS&BFS的基本原理 之后 我们再看几道例题。 例一: 找女朋友 题目描述 : X,作为户外运动的忠实爱好者,总是不想呆在家里。现在,他想把死宅Y从家里拉出来。问从X的家到Y的家的最短时间是多少。 为了简化问题,我们把地图抽象为n*m的矩阵,行编号从上到下为1 到 n,列编号从左到右为1 到 m。矩阵...